The West Clare peninsula is an area of unspoilt, natural beauty wedged between the roaring Atlantic to the north, and the more tranquil Shannon estuary to the south. At its most westerly point, Loop Head the river Shannon ends its 212.5 mile journey from the Shannon Pot in county Cavan, and enters the Atlantic ocean.…
The charming little village of Allihies in Cork, with its brightly coloured houses, is the last village at the end of the Beara Peninsula. It sits between a rocky mountain range and the rugged Atlantic Coast.
Copper was mined in the hill behind the village from 1812, when a rich copper deposit was discovered in…

Experience the enchanting beauty of Crag Cave. Older than mankind itself, Crag Cave was not discovered until 1983. Today, Ireland's most exciting showcave is an all weather visitor attraction located just north of Castleisland, the gateway to Kerry.
An ancient fossil cave system over 1 million years old, Crag Cave was formed by underground rivers…
